God's Living Story for Young People
Storyline is a new, fresh, 12 session resource produced by Urban Saints, which takes young people (aged 11+) on a journey where they will understand, and experience, the story of God as revealed in the Bible.
Storyline takes an active, hands on, learning-through-experience approach, enabling young people to encounter and explore themes, feelings and ideas relevant to the material covered in each session.
The emphasis in each session is on creative communication and expression, rather than listening to someone talking. Young people will be encouraged to consider what they can learn about God, themselves, others and the creation as appropriate in ach session. they will be given opportunities to respond to what they have learned, in creative and reflection and prayer.
This course is aimed at both Christians and non-Christians and includes a range of top quality resources including...![]()
- A comprehensive leaders guide
- Video clips
- Music
- Handouts

This course will give young people an overview of the Big Story of the Bible - an understanding that this strange assortment of ancient books is all interlinked, purposeful, intentional and part of an ongoing adventure. It will help them understand God’s dealings with people throughout the history of the world, from the creation of the world, to the present day and into the future. It will help young people locate themselves in this big story, to understand God’s plans and purposes in their lives and to respond to God’s invitation to be part of his kingdom. They will gain a deep understanding that they are part of this story and its continuation, that their roots go back to creation and their future can be in the new creation. It will provide space for them to encounter the God of the Bible.
Young people with some Bible knowledge will be able to make connections between previously disparate stories and characters, and see how they slot into the biblical narrative. Those who have never experienced the Bible before will learn how to approach it, as the overarching story of God’s dealings with the people that he created. They will get to know some of the names of key characters in the Bible, but by no means all.
